Damaged plumbing replacement services involve removing and replacing faulty or deteriorating plumbing components within a property. This process typically includes identifying the affected pipes or fixtures, safely removing the damaged sections, and installing new plumbing systems that meet current standards. These services are essential when existing pipes have become corroded, cracked, or otherwise compromised, leading to leaks or blockages that can disrupt water flow and cause property damage. Professional plumbers ensure that the replacement work is performed efficiently and correctly to restore proper plumbing function.

This service addresses a variety of plumbing issues that can develop over time, such as persistent leaks, low water pressure, or frequent pipe bursts. Damaged pipes can lead to water damage, mold growth, and increased utility bills if not addressed promptly. Replacement services help prevent further deterioration by removing compromised plumbing and installing durable, reliable systems. Proper replacement also reduces the risk of future leaks and pipe failures, contributing to the overall safety and functionality of the property's plumbing infrastructure.

Replacement Costs - Damaged plumbing replacement typically ranges from $1,000 to $4,000, depending on the extent of damage and pipe materials used. For example, replacing a section of broken pipes in a residential property might cost around $2,000. Costs can vary based on local labor rates and material choices.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for damaged plumbing replacement usually fall between $50 and $150 per hour. The total labor cost depends on the project's complexity and duration, with simple repairs often taking a few hours and more extensive work taking longer.

Material Costs - The price of replacement pipes and fittings generally ranges from $10 to $50 per linear foot. Materials like copper tend to be more expensive, while PVC options are typically more affordable, influencing overall costs.

Additional Charges - Extra costs may include permits, disposal fees, or repairs to surrounding structures, which can add several hundred dollars to the total. These expenses vary based on local regulations and specific project requ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of damaged plumbing that needs replacement? Signs include persistent leaks, low water pressure, foul odors, visible corrosion, or frequent clogs that cannot be resolved with repairs.

How do professionals determine if plumbing needs replacement? Pros typically assess the age, condition, and extent of damage through inspections and may perform pressure tests or drain evaluations.

What types of plumbing components are usually replaced? Common replacements involve pipes, fittings, fixtures, and sometimes entire sections of the plumbing system depending on damage severity.
